Abstract

Description of case(s): We have studied 11 patients with benign liver steatosis (BLS). The control group comprised five patients with normal body mass index (index < 25 kg/m2) and normal liver. We performed regular abdominal ultrasound using routine protocol, and, additionally, densitometry of skin (as a standard), liver (three different parts: 1) closer to the anterior surface, 2) middle part, 3) closer to the posterior surface), and right kidney parenchyma (as the second standard) for all patients with BLS and control group. Body mass index (BMI) was measured for all individuals. All studies were performed with a convex transducer 3 MHz on GE-Logiq 500. The settings of the scanner for studies were the same: gain 60, power 70, all time gain compensation knobs were in neutral position. Densitometry (gray scale echo level) was performed using a built-in feature of measurement of the ultrasound scanner. We used descriptive statistics and t-test. Mean BMI for the patients with BLS was 30.1 kg/m2, for the control group 19.7 kg/m2. The mean densitometry statistics of the liver of the patients with BLS in different parts were: 1) 25.9, 2) 17.2, 3) 7.2; and in the control group: 1) 18, 2) 21.6, 3) 22.2. The main disparity between BLS and normal liver by ultrasound densitometry was the farthest portion of the liver. We calculated a separate index: ratio of this part of the liver to density of the skin. This parameter was significantly different (P<0.01) between two groups.
